Kirkuk blast toll reaches 22 dead, 150 wounded |
2008-07-29 |
(VOI) -- Casualties from the suicide blast that targeted a crowd of demonstrators in downtown Kirkuk city earlier today have reached 172, a local police chief said on Monday. "The toll has risen to 22 dead and 150 wounded, all civilians," Brigadier Sarhad Qadir told Aswat al-Iraq - Voices of Iraq - (VOI). Earlier today the assistant police chief in Kirkuk, Colonel Salar Khaled, told VOI that 13 persons were killed and 79 others, including Yahia al-Barzanji, an Associated Press photographer, Simon Mohammed, a photographer for the satellite Baghdad channel, were wounded when a suicide bomber blew himself up among a crowd of demonstrators in downtown Kirkuk. More than five thousand people took to the streets in Kirkuk, condemning the passage of the provincial council elections law, which includes an article postponing the city's elections. |
